Armox
    Armox Academy 📚
    核心概念画布编辑器

    Canvas 编辑器

    Canvas 是 Armox 的核心创作空间:一个可视化、基于节点(node)的编辑器。你可以把不同组件连接起来,构建强大的内容生成工作流。

    Canvas 是什么?

    Complete Canvas Workflow

    一个完整工作流示例:多个节点连接在一起形成内容生成管线。

    Canvas 是 Armox 的可视化工作流编辑器。你不需要写代码或操作复杂界面,而是:

    • 🎨 拖拽 节点到画布
    • 🔗 用连线 连接 节点
    • ▶️ 一键 运行 工作流
    • 👀 在画布里直接 查看结果

    你可以把它理解成“能真正跑起来的流程图”:每个框(node)做一件事,连线代表数据如何在节点之间流动。


    Canvas 界面概览

    打开一个 Canvas,你会看到:

    AreaPurpose
    Main Canvas带网格背景的工作区
    Left Sidebar可添加的节点类型
    Top ToolbarCanvas 名称、保存、Run All、设置
    Minimap整个画布的缩略图(右下角)
    Right Panel选中节点时显示其 settings

    缩放(Zooming)

    • 滚轮 — 放大/缩小
    • 触控板捏合 — Trackpad 手势
    • 缩放按钮 — 工具栏里的 controls

    平移(Panning)

    • 空白处点击并拖拽
    • 鼠标中键 点击并拖拽
    • 空格 + 拖拽 — 另一种方式

    Minimap

    右下角 minimap 显示整个画布:

    • Click minimap 跳转到对应区域
    • Drag 视口框进行导航
    • 在 settings 里可 Toggle 显示/隐藏

    创建新的 Canvas

    1. 在侧边栏点击 Canvas
    2. 点击 + New Canvas
    3. 输入 Canvas 名称
    4. 开始添加节点!

    Empty Canvas Editor

    一个全新的空白画布,等待你搭建工作流。

    Canvas 会在你操作时自动保存(auto-save)。


    添加节点(Adding Nodes)

    从侧边栏添加

    1. 打开 left sidebar(若隐藏可点击菜单图标)
    2. 浏览节点分类:
      • Text — prompts 与文本生成
      • Image — AI 图像生成
      • Video — AI 视频生成
      • Audio — 音乐与语音
      • Upload — 你的文件
      • Tools — 处理与增强
    3. Drag 节点到画布,或 click 直接添加

    Add Node Panel

    Add Node 面板:按类别展示所有可用节点类型。

    快速添加(Quick Add)

    • 在画布上 Right-click 打开右键菜单
    • 选择 node 类型,会在当前位置添加

    选择节点(Selecting Nodes)

    单选(Single Selection)

    • Click 一个节点即可选中
    • 选中节点会显示高亮边框
    • 右侧面板会显示节点 settings

    多选(Multiple Selection)

    • Shift + Click — 增加到选择
    • 拖拽框选 — 一次选择多个节点
    • Ctrl/Cmd + A — 全选

    移动节点(Moving Nodes)

    • Drag 已选节点移动位置
    • 方向键 微调位置
    • 多选时会一起移动

    连接节点(Connecting Nodes)

    创建连接(Creating Connections)

    1. 找到源节点右侧的 output handle(小圆点)
    2. 从 output handle Click and drag
    3. 拖到目标节点左侧的 input handle
    4. 松开即可创建连接

    连接颜色(Connection Colors)

    连接按数据类型做颜色区分:

    ColorTypeExample
    YellowTextPrompts, descriptions
    BlueImagePhotos, graphics
    GreenVideoClips, animations
    OrangeAudioMusic, speech

    删除连接(Deleting Connections)

    • Click 连线选中
    • DeleteBackspace
    • right-click 选择 “Delete”

    节点设置(Node Settings)

    选中节点后,右侧面板会显示 settings:

    常见设置(Common Settings)

    SettingDescription
    Model使用哪个 AI 模型
    Prompt文本输入(AI 节点常见)
    Aspect Ratio输出尺寸
    Quality输出质量

    可折叠分区(Collapsible Sections)

    settings 通常按分区组织:

    • Basic — 关键设置
    • Advanced — 精细调整
    • Output — 预览与下载

    运行工作流(Running Workflows)

    运行单个节点(Run a Single Node)

    1. Select 要运行的节点
    2. 点击节点上的 ▶ Play
    3. 观察进度指示
    4. 在节点预览中查看结果

    运行整条工作流(Run Entire Workflow)

    1. 点击工具栏的 Run All
    2. 节点会按连接关系顺序运行
    3. 每个节点会显示进度
    4. 结果会随着节点完成逐步出现

    执行顺序(Execution Order)

    节点按依赖顺序执行:

    1. 没有输入依赖的节点先跑
    2. 再跑依赖它们输出的节点
    3. 直到所有节点完成

    查看结果(Viewing Results)

    节点内预览(In-Node Preview)

    生成内容会直接显示在节点里:

    • Images — 缩略图预览
    • Videos — 视频播放器
    • Audio — 音频播放器
    • Text — 文本展示

    全屏预览(Full Preview)

    • Click 预览可放大查看
    • 点击 Download 保存到电脑
    • 内容也会保存到 Gallery

    保存与组织(Saving and Organizing)

    自动保存(Auto-Save)

    Canvas 会自动保存。工具栏会显示 “Saved” 指示。

    手动保存(Manual Save)

    • Ctrl/Cmd + S 强制保存
    • 或点击工具栏 Save

    重命名(Renaming)

    1. 点击工具栏里的 canvas 名称
    2. 输入新名称
    3. 按 Enter

    组织 Canvas(Organizing Canvases)

    • 用描述性命名
    • 使用命名规范(如 “Client - Project - Version”)
    • 删除不再需要的旧 canvases

    键盘快捷键(Keyboard Shortcuts)

    ActionShortcut
    SaveCtrl/Cmd + S
    UndoCtrl/Cmd + Z
    RedoCtrl/Cmd + Shift + Z
    Select AllCtrl/Cmd + A
    Delete SelectedDelete / Backspace
    Zoom InCtrl/Cmd + Plus
    Zoom OutCtrl/Cmd + Minus
    Fit ViewCtrl/Cmd + 0
    PanSpacebar + Drag

    Canvas 最佳实践

    布局建议(Layout Tips)

    • 从左到右流动 — 左边输入,右边输出
    • 留出空隙 — 节点别挤太紧
    • 分组 — 相关节点放近一点
    • 用 minimap — 大画布更好导航

    工作流建议(Workflow Tips)

    • 从简单开始 — 先 2-3 个节点,再扩展
    • 增量测试 — 逐个节点运行验证
    • 经常保存 — auto-save 有用,但手动保存也安心
    • 命名清晰 — 方便回找与复用

    性能建议(Performance Tips)

    • 别过载 — 超大 Canvas 可能变慢
    • 按需运行 — 只跑你需要的节点
    • 清理 — 删除不用的节点与连接

    Troubleshooting

    Canvas 无法加载(Canvas Won't Load)

    • 刷新页面
    • 检查网络连接
    • 换浏览器

    节点无法连接(Nodes Won't Connect)

    • 检查类型是否兼容(颜色匹配或 text 到多数输入)
    • 确认是从 output 拖到 input
    • 尝试删除并重新连接

    结果没有出现(Results Not Appearing)

    • 确认节点已完成(不再转圈)
    • 查看节点是否有错误信息
    • 检查 credits 余额

    下一步

    熟悉 Canvas 后,继续深入: